The 2022–23 NBA season is just around the corner with almost every team holding its Media Day activities on Monday.
A lot has happened—and was thought to be happening—since the Warriors defeated the Celtics in the NBA Finals. Nets star Kevin Durant requested a trade, but then elected to stay in Brooklyn … for now. The Jazz traded both of their former franchise centerpieces, with Rudy Gobert now with the Timberwolves and Donovan Mitchell now a Cavalier. Suns and Mercury owner Robert Sarver announced his intention to sell the teams following a months-long investigation, one week after NBA commissioner Adam Silver dealt him a one-year ban and $10 million fine.
